#1 Posted: 1/13/2012 10:15:29 AM I am looking forward to another good slate of playoff games this weekend. Last week brought in a good Forecast going 4-1, and I am hopeful to follow up with another strong weekend. After breaking things down throughout the week, I like the dogs to be barking loud this weekend with Denver, Houston, and the Giants all keeping it within the number. I like the Giants and Houston to win s/u and think that New Orleans will get the Giants at home next week in the NFC Championship. I just can't go against the Saints right now, even against a stout defense away from home. San Francisco struggles mightily in the red zone, and pay dirt will be needed at a steady pace for the 49'ers to prevail in this game. I think that Houston is being undervalued in reference to their opponent, the set line and the way their defense is playing and has played all season. They match-up well with Baltimore and I think this one will come down to the final drive and one possession.
These sides are final, I might throw in a few totals before the games kick off on Saturday.
